The 32nd player taken in the draft last year got $14.7mm with a $7.3mm signing bonus.

No way Ty makes anywhere near that next year in NIL, and if he’s chosen top 10 you’re talking closer to $30mm/$15mm.

He probably should go if he gets a pretty consensus amount of feedback that he will be drafted in the 1st half of the 1st Round at worst.

If there is some doubt that it could maybe be a lower 1st round pick then it could be a risky situation where he’s one of those guys just sitting there all night with the camera on him and he falls to the 2nd round.

The avg 2nd round contract is about $8 Mil with a $4 Mil signing bonus.

His NIL right now is estimated to be around $2.5 Mil so it’s not a massive difference in right now monies.

If falling to the 2nd round is a legitimate risk he might be better off playing another year in CFB.
